Senator Ben Cardin (D-MD) made a unanimous consent request to bring up a bill that would fund all the closed parts of the government except for the Homeland Security Department.
Senate Majority Leader McConnell (R-KY) objected, saying Democrats must negotiate with President Trump before the Senate considered any spending bills.
Senator Van Hollen (D-MD) then made a unanimous consent request to bring up a short-term continuing resolution to re-open the Homeland Security Department. Senator McConnell objected. close
